Cholera case definition
This document contains the case definitions for Cholera which is nationally notifiable within Australia. This definition should be used to determine whether a case should be notified.

Reporting
Only confirmed cases should be notified.Confirmed case
A confirmed case requires laboratory definitive evidence only.Laboratory definitive evidence
Isolation of toxigenic Vibrio cholerae O1 or O139.
